There is no MOT test data available for the 1988 Peugeot 309 SR Auto in the DVLA light-vehicle database, so we cannot compare its pass rate against the UK average or assess failure patterns from recent tests. This 35-year-old hatchback sits at a CarHunch score of 50, reflecting the inherent uncertainty of evaluating a vehicle this old without modern test records.

If you're considering one, focus on the physical inspection: check for rust (a known weak point on 80s Peugeots), verify the automatic transmission operates smoothly, and inspect the cooling system carefully. Any example this old will need comprehensive pre-purchase checks by a specialist rather than reliance on MOT history.

We have 613 1988 Peugeot 309 Sr Auto vehicles on record, but none have light-vehicle MOT history in our data source.

There are a few reasons this can happen:

  • Heavy commercial vehicle — trucks, buses and coaches over 3.5 tonnes are tested under the DVSA annual HGV/PSV regime, which uses a separate database not included in our data source
  • Imported vehicles — vehicles registered abroad and recently brought to the UK may have no UK MOT history yet
  • MOT-exempt — vehicles manufactured before 1986 qualify under the 40-year rolling exemption; some specialist and agricultural vehicles are also exempt
  • Never used on public roads — some vehicles are registered but kept off-road and have never required an MOT
